The Path Moving Forward For Ex Ethereum Miners Remains Unclear

As former Ethereum miners navigate the evolving landscape of cryptocurrency mining, the road ahead seems hazy. With Ethereum’s shift to a proof-of-stake model and the challenges associated with mining, many are searching for new opportunities and strategies to sustain their mining operations.

One potential avenue for ex-Ethereum miners is to pivot to mining other cryptocurrencies that still rely on proof-of-work consensus mechanisms, such as Bitcoin or Litecoin. By leveraging their existing mining hardware and expertise, miners can continue to generate income in this competitive space.

Another option is to explore emerging cryptocurrencies that offer innovative consensus algorithms or unique mining incentives. For instance, some newer coins utilize proof-of-space or proof-of-time mechanisms, which may provide a more energy-efficient and cost-effective mining alternative compared to traditional proof-of-work models.

Additionally, miners can consider joining mining pools or collective mining efforts to increase their chances of earning rewards and reduce the impact of individual equipment limitations. Pooling resources with other miners can enhance profitability and help navigate the uncertainties of the mining landscape.

As technology evolves, ex-Ethereum miners should also stay informed about advancements in mining hardware and software. Upgrading equipment to more efficient models or exploring cloud mining options could optimize mining operations and adapt to changing market conditions.

Furthermore, diversifying mining activities beyond cryptocurrency mining alone could offer new revenue streams. Some miners explore activities such as hosting masternodes, providing hosting services, or participating in decentralized finance (DeFi) platforms to supplement their income.
